## Authentication

Tracepath propagates a correlation header across all Northgate microservices. Spans are collected by the trace aggregator and queryable within roughly 30 seconds. On-call engineers investigating an incident should query the aggregator directly rather than individual services. Aggregator queries require authenticated access; include in the Authorization header the bearer token shown below.

portal login ticket: eyJhbGciOiJIUzI1NiIsInR5cCI6IkpXVCJ9.eyJzdWIiOiIMjvRAf3PEFIn0.nuv9gjixLtnr

- [ ] Step 7: Archive cold storage buckets (Glacierline tier). Confirm both ceremony witnesses are present, verify bucket manifests match the Oxbow ledger, then seal the archive key shares. Plugin authors may observe but not handle shares. Once sealed, the archive index itself is encrypted and can only be reopened with the passphrase below.

vault phrase of badup-hahig = tamael-aldael-kelmir-istael-fenok-istwyn-tamius-jorath-oliion

Step 7 covers the locker access flow for SudsPoint, the laundry-locker service run by Fernhollow Apartments. When a resident scans their code, the kiosk requests a one-time unlock token from the Lockerbrain API, which checks the order state before releasing the door. Tokens expire in 90 seconds, so replay risk is pretty narrow. Heads up: the kiosk firmware validates every unlock payload against our signing chain, so nothing unsigned ever moves a latch. The current signing key follows.

deploy key for kajof-fajop: bky6_gDHw9Q